![]() The standard memory gives you just under 12 seconds of stereo sampling at 44.1kHz, or, at the other extreme, around 47 seconds of mono sampling at 22.05kHz. Two megabytes of memory are fitted as standard, upgradable in 2Mb steps to a maximum 8Mb. Additionally the S1000 is one of a growing number of samplers which use fixed-rate sample playback. ![]() Sample quality is impressively clean and sharp - we're entering real "defy you to tell the difference" territory here. No wonder the demands placed on samplers are growing rapidly.Īkai's response is the S1000, a linear 16-bit stereo sampler with 24-bit internal processing, switchable 44.1kHz/22.05kHz sampling rate and 16-voice polyphony.
